Platelet Rich Plasma (PRP)

Uses your own blood to speed up healing in tendons and joints, with virtually no risk of rejection.

Lipogems (Stem Cells)

Uses your own fat tissue to support natural joint regeneration, often combined with PRP.

Tenex

A minimally invasive procedure that removes damaged tendon tissue with precision.

ESWT Shockwave Therapy

Uses targeted sound waves to relieve chronic pain in the Achilles, shoulder, plantar fascia and hip.

Ostenil (Hyaluronic Acid)

Visco supplementation injections that restore joint lubrication and reduce pain.

Cellular Matrix Injections

Combines your own blood with hyaluronic acid for added joint support and comfort.

Spinal and Nerve Injections

Facet joint, sacroiliac, transforaminal epidural and medial branch block injections for back pain.

Diagnostic Ultrasound

Soft tissue, tendon and joint imaging that helps us reach an accurate diagnosis quickly.

Human Performance and Longevity

VO2 max testing, gait analysis, metabolic health checks and weight management programmes.

Frequently Asked Questions

Regenerative medicine uses your body’s own healing ability, through treatments like PRP and Lipogems, to repair damaged tissue and relieve pain without surgery.

PRP uses platelets from your own blood to support healing in tendons and joints. Lipogems uses your own fat tissue and is generally used for more significant joint damage. Both can be combined for added effect.

Some treatments, such as certain PRP injections, are covered by insurers depending on your policy. Others, including Lipogems and Tenex, are not typically covered. We recommend checking with your insurer before booking.

Most regenerative treatments have minimal downtime, and many patients return to normal activity the same day. Your clinician will give you specific aftercare advice based on your procedure.

Depending on your condition, we may use MRI, X-ray, ultrasound or a DEXA bone density scan to confirm the diagnosis before recommending a treatment. This ensures the injection or procedure targets the exact structure causing your pain rather than guessing based on symptoms alone.

Follow-up after Lipogems includes a telemedicine consultation as standard, so we can check your progress without requiring another clinic visit. Further in-person follow-up is arranged if your recovery needs closer monitoring.

A single PRP injection can help, but tendon and joint tissue typically responds better to a course of injections spaced a few weeks apart, allowing the growth factors to stimulate healing in stages. That is why we offer PRP as a three-session package alongside single injections.

The procedure uses gentle heat delivered through a fine needle to disable the specific nerves sending pain signals from a joint or the spine to your brain. Relief typically lasts several months to over a year, and the treatment can be repeated if the nerve regenerates.
